When my wife's grandpa passed away, he left us his tool box. Mainly US made brands like Snap-on, SK and Proto, really great tools. I filled the gaps with Williams tools, a Snap-On Industrial brand, made in USA but not quite as expensive. I would NEVER buy a made in China tool, even if they work ok. I just work too hard for my money to just throw it away, plus : a good tool might be expensive at first, but it also is a lasting value I can pass on to my kids.
As my Grandma used to say: "we are too poor to buy cheap stuff." think about it.
